* { padding:0; margin:0;}

	html { font-size:100.01%;}

	body { font-size:62.5%; font-family: Arial, Helvetica, sans-serif; background:url(images/mavrick_bg_red1.jpg) no-repeat center 0 #171717; color:#747474;}

	

.clear { clear: both;}



	table, td, div, img { border:0; border-collapse:collapse;}

	td {vertical-align:top;}

	ul { list-style: none;}

		

a, .comments a:hover {text-decoration: underline; color:#fff;}

a:hover, .comments a {text-decoration: none;}





	html body textarea { font-family: Georgia; font-size:12px; color:#747474;}

	

.main { width:963px; margin:0 auto; }	

	

	.headerz { height:64px;background:url(images/menu_bg.png) no-repeat center 0;}



#musicplayer {width:250px;height:31px;margin-top: 5px;}

#search {width:330px;height:31px;margin-top: 5px; margin-top: 180px; float:right; margin-bottom: 12px;}

.topmenu {

	list-style: none;

	padding: 0;

	margin: 0;

	padding-top: 8px;

	padding-left: 3px;

	width: 963px;

	height: 43px;

}

.topmenu li {	float: left; margin-left: 11px; }

.topmenu a {

display:block;

	width: 86px;

	height: 25px;

	text-align:right;

	padding-right: 8px;

	padding-top: 22px;

	background: url(images/menu_item.png) bottom right no-repeat;

	font-family: Impact; font-size:14px; color:#747474; text-decoration:none;

}

.topmenu a:hover { background-position: 0 -47px; color:#FFFFFF;}

.topmenu .mselect a {background-position: left top; color:#FFFFFF;}



	.content { clear:both; overflow:hidden; height:100%; background:url(images/bg.png) repeat 0 0;}

	.content .bg-left { background:url(images/border.png) repeat-y 0 0;height:100%;}

	.content .bg-right { background:url(images/border.png) repeat-y right 0;height:100%;}

	.content .bg-top { background:url(images/border.png) repeat-x 0 0;height:100%;}

	.content .bg-bot { background:url(images/border.png) repeat-x 0 bottom;height:100%;}

	

	.content .corner-left-top { background:url(images/corner-left-top.png) no-repeat 0 0;height:100%;}

	.content .corner-right-top { background:url(images/corner-right-top.png) no-repeat right 0;height:100%;}

	.content .corner-left-bot { background:url(images/corner-left-bot.png) no-repeat 0 bottom;height:100%;}

	.content .corner-right-bot { background:url(images/corner-right-bot.png) no-repeat right bottom; height:100%; overflow:hidden; padding:25px 25px 25px 25px;	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#FCFCFC;
	line-height: 20px;}
	.content .corner-right-bot img { margin: 10px; }

	

.newscl {

width: 573px;

 background: url(images/news_title.png) top left no-repeat;

 padding-top: 50px;

 padding-left: 20px;

 min-height: 300px;



}



.newsblock { background: url(images/newsbbg.png) bottom right no-repeat;display:block;padding-bottom: 10px;padding-top: 10px;border-bottom: 1px solid #666666;



}

.newsblock img {border: 0px;margin: 8px;float:left;display:block;}

.newsblock h2 { font: bold 24px "Times New Roman", Times, serif ; color:#ff8400;}

.newsblock h3 {font: bold 15px "Times New Roman", Times, serif ; color:#515151;}

.newsblock p {

text-indent: 10px;font: normal 15px "Times New Roman", Times, serif ; color:#fff;



}

	.column-right { width:322px; float:right; margin:0px 0px 0px 38px; }

.widget { height:100%; overflow:hidden; background:url(images/widget-bg05.gif) repeat-y 0 0; margin:0px 0px 0px 0px;}

.title {background:url(images/widget-bg-top05.gif) no-repeat 0 0;}

	.widget-bg { background:url(images/widget-bg-bot05.gif) no-repeat 0 bottom; padding:0px 10px 24px 26px; overflow:hidden; height:100%;}

	

	.widget .title { height:100%;  margin:0px -10px 10px -26px; overflow:hidden;}

	

	.widget h2 { height:100%; overflow:hidden; background:url(images/widget-line04.gif) repeat-x 0 bottom;  }

	.widget h2 { font:1.8em Georgia; color:#fff; padding:20px 10px 12px 16px; }

	

	.widget ul { height:100%; font-size:18px; margin:0px 0px 0px 0px; }

	.widget ul li {padding:0px 0px 10px 0px; line-height: 23px;}

	

	.widget ul li a { text-decoration: none;}

	.widget ul li a:hover { text-decoration: underline; color: red;}

	

	.widget a { }



	.column-right .widget .title {*width:322px;}









.timegr_date {background:url(images/date_bg.gif) no-repeat 0 0; width: 87px; height: 23px; padding-top: 3px;float:left; text-align:center;

font: normal 13px Impact; color:#473e31;}



.serachfld {
margin-top: 6px;
margin-left: 20px;
width: 220px;
text-align:center;
border: 0px;
font: normal 14px Verdana, Arial, Helvetica, sans-serif;
color:#FF9900;
background: #171717;
float:left;
}
.searchbtn{
display: block;
width: 60px;
height: 24px;
background: url(/images/searchbtn.jpg) no-repeat top left;
float:left;
margin-top: 4px;
margin-left: 15px;
}







